Criar um relatório#
Cria um novo relatório de por nome e define as partes que devem constar nele. [Código do Produto: PCS_UN_RelatorioProcsPorParte
]
Nota
Requer módulo “(IP/API) Relatórios: relatório de saneamento por nome”. Para mais informações entre em contato com o suporte.
cURL
curl -X POST 'https://op.digesto.com.br/api/relatorio-judicial/live_report_def/create_update_from_terms' \
-H 'Content-Type: application/json' \
-H 'Accept: application/json' \
-H 'Authorization: Bearer <token>' \
-d '{
"terms":{
"persons":[
{
"included":"digesto",
}
],
},
"name":"digesto"
}'
Parâmetro |
Tipo |
Descrição |
---|---|---|
object |
Termos incluídos na busca. Podem ser |
|
ID |
integer |
ID do relatório existente a ser modificado. Se não for passado, um novo é criado. Não é permitido modificar. |
distribuido_from |
string |
Filtro referente a data de distribuição dos processos, traz apenas os processos que foram distribuídos após a data cadastrada nesse filtro, o valor padrão é a data 1990-01-01 (opcional). |
distribuido_to |
string |
Filtro referente a data de distribuição dos processos, traz apenas os processos que foram distribuídos nessa data ou antes da data cadastrada, o valor padrão dele é a data 2022-12-31 (ano corrente) (opcional). |
excluded_tribunais |
list |
Filtro referente ao tribunal onde o processo foi distribuído, exclui todos os processos do tribunal que estiver nessa lista (opcional). |
Relatórios já encomendados
Parâmetro |
Tipo |
Descrição |
---|---|---|
name |
string |
Nome do relatório por nome. |
ID |
integer |
ID do novo relatório por nome gerado. Deve ser armazenado pois será usado nos próximos passos do fluxo. |
Resposta
HTTP/1.1 200 OK
Content-Type: application/json
81801
Obter dados prévios consolidados de um relatório#
Traz dados prévios consolidados sobre a quantidade de processos das partes escolhidas para este relatório.
Nota
Requer módulo “(IP/API) Relatórios: relatório de saneamento por nome”. Para mais informações entre em contato com o suporte.
curl -X GET 'https://op.digesto.com.br/api/relatorio-judicial/live_report_def/<id>/preview_totals' \
-H 'Content-Type: application/json' \
-H 'Host: op.digesto.com.br' \
-H 'Accept: application/json'
Parâmetro |
Tipo |
Descrição |
---|---|---|
relatorio_id |
integer |
ID do relatório a ser consultado. |
Exemplo de chamada
cURL
curl -X GET 'https://op.digesto.com.br/api/relatorio-judicial/live_report_def/81801/preview_totals' \
-H 'Content-Type: application/json' \
-H 'Host: op.digesto.com.br' \
-H 'Accept: application/json'
Resposta
HTTP/1.1 200 OK
Vary: Accept
Content-Type: application/json
{
"ano_max":2022,
"ano_min":1900,
"data_distribuicao":[
[
"2012",
"2"
],
[
"2013",
"3"
],
[
"2014",
"13"
],
[
"2015",
"8"
],
[
"2016",
"9"
],
[
"2017",
"25"
],
[
"2018",
"19"
],
[
"2019",
"12"
],
[
"2020",
"6"
],
[
"2021",
"2"
],
[
"2022",
"1"
]
],
"is_monitored_parts":false,
"mes_max":12,
"mes_min":1,
"naturezas":[
[
"OUTROS",
0,
10,
0,
true
],
[
"PENAL",
0,
10,
1,
true
],
[
"C\u00cdVEL",
0,
10,
2,
true
],
[
"ADMINISTRATIVO",
0,
10,
3,
true
],
[
"TRIBUT\u00c1RIO",
0,
10,
4,
true
],
[
"TRABALHISTA",
0,
10,
5,
true
],
[
"PREVIDENCI\u00c1RIA",
0,
10,
6,
true
],
[
"CAUTELAR OU MEDIDA PR\u00c9-PROCESSUAL",
0,
10,
7,
true
],
[
"INCIDENTES PROCESSUAIS",
0,
10,
8,
true
],
[
"RECURSOS E REM\u00c9DIOS CONSTITUCIONAIS",
0,
10,
9,
true
],
[
"REM\u00c9DIOS CONSTITUCIONAIS",
0,
10,
10,
true
],
[
"MILITAR",
0,
10,
11,
true
],
[
"JUIZADO ESPECIAL CIVEL",
0,
10,
12,
true
],
[
"JUIZADO ESPECIAL FEDERAL",
0,
10,
13,
true
],
[
"JUIZADO ESPECIAL CRIMINAL",
0,
10,
14,
true
],
[
"SUPREMO TRIBUNAL FEDERAL",
0,
10,
15,
true
],
[
"SUPERIOR TRIBUNAL DE JUSTI\u00c7A",
0,
10,
16,
true
],
[
"ARQUIVO",
0,
10,
17,
true
],
[
"A\u00c7\u00c3O CIVIL P\u00daBLICA",
0,
10,
18,
true
]
],
"partes":[
{
"checked":true,
"id":387167,
"nome":"digesto",
"parte_max_total":20,
"total_procs_variacoes":100,
"variacoes":[
[
"DIGESTO PESQUISA E BANCO DE DADOS LTDA",
52,
52,
17996356,
true,
52
],
[
"Digesto Pesquisa de Banco de Dados Ltda",
13,
13,
33367615,
true,
13
],
[
"Digesto Pesquisa e Banco de Dados S.A.",
10,
10,
67684826,
true,
10
],
[
"RADAR OFICIAL ( DIGESTO PESQUISA E BANCO DE DADOS LTDA)",
4,
4,
23619064,
true,
4
],
[
"DIGESTO PESQUISA E BANCO DE DADOS LTDA. ? RADAR OFICIAL",
3,
3,
46139054,
true,
3
],
[
"DIGESTO PESQUISA E BANCO DE DADOS LTDA - RADAR OFICIAL",
3,
3,
53346163,
true,
3
],
[
"Digesto Pesquisa de Banco de Dados",
2,
2,
32086885,
true,
2
],
[
"DIGESTO PESQUISA E BANCO DE DADOS S.A. (RADAR OFICIAL)",
2,
2,
66154538,
true,
2
],
[
"RADAR OFICIAL - DIGESTO PESQUISA E BANCO DE DADOS LTDA",
2,
2,
41606572,
true,
2
],
[
"digesto pesquisa e banco de dados ltda (radar)",
1,
1,
31470880,
true,
1
],
[
"Digesto Pesquisa e Bancos de Dados Ltda",
1,
1,
18775947,
true,
1
],
[
"DIGESTO PESQUISA E BANCO DE DADOS LTDA [SITE RADAR OFICIAL.COM.BR]",
1,
1,
37876849,
true,
1
],
[
"Digesto Pesquisa e Banco de Dados Ltda (radaroficial.com.br)",
1,
1,
68674578,
true,
1
],
[
"DIGESTO PESQUISA E BANCOS DE DADOS S A RADAR OFICIAL",
1,
1,
75803859,
true,
1
],
[
"DIGESTO PESQUISA E BANCO DE DADOS LTDA [SITE RADAR",
1,
1,
57181812,
true,
1
],
[
"Arquivo Judicial / Radar Oficial - Digesto Pesquisa e Banco de Dados Ltda",
1,
1,
64577270,
true,
1
],
[
"A DIGESTO PESQUISAS E BANCO DE DADOS LTDA- RADAR OFICIAL",
1,
1,
57484349,
true,
1
],
[
"DIGESTO PESQUISA E BANCO DADOS LTDA",
1,
1,
62563315,
true,
1
],
[
"DIGESTO PESQUISA E BANDO DE DADOS LTDA",
0,
0,
65753919,
true,
0
],
[
"Digesto Pesquisa de Banco de Dados Ltda - Radar Oficial Internet Ltda",
0,
0,
87700068,
true,
0
]
]
}
],
"total_cost":250.0,
"total_procs":100,
"total_procs_max":100,
"tribunais":[
[
"TRF1",
0,
0,
8,
true
],
[
"TRF2",
1,
1,
9,
true
],
[
"TRF3",
0,
0,
10,
true
],
[
"TRF4",
0,
0,
11,
true
],
[
"TRF5",
0,
0,
12,
true
],
[
"TRT1",
0,
0,
13,
true
],
[
"TRT2",
0,
0,
14,
true
],
[
"TRT3",
0,
0,
15,
true
],
[
"TRT4",
0,
0,
16,
true
],
[
"TRT5",
0,
0,
17,
true
],
[
"TRT6",
0,
0,
18,
true
],
[
"TRT7",
0,
0,
19,
true
],
[
"TRT8",
0,
0,
20,
true
],
[
"TRT9",
0,
0,
21,
true
],
[
"TRT10",
0,
0,
22,
true
],
[
"TRT11",
0,
0,
23,
true
],
[
"TRT12",
0,
0,
24,
true
],
[
"TRT13",
0,
0,
25,
true
],
[
"TRT14",
0,
0,
26,
true
],
[
"TRT15",
0,
0,
27,
true
],
[
"TRT16",
0,
0,
28,
true
],
[
"TRT17",
0,
0,
29,
true
],
[
"TRT18",
0,
0,
30,
true
],
[
"TRT19",
0,
0,
31,
true
],
[
"TRT20",
0,
0,
32,
true
],
[
"TRT21",
0,
0,
33,
true
],
[
"TRT22",
0,
0,
34,
true
],
[
"TRT23",
0,
0,
35,
true
],
[
"TRT24",
0,
0,
36,
true
],
[
"TJAC",
0,
0,
37,
true
],
[
"TJAL",
0,
0,
38,
true
],
[
"TJAP",
0,
0,
39,
true
],
[
"TJAM",
0,
0,
40,
true
],
[
"TJBA",
5,
5,
41,
true
],
[
"TJCE",
2,
2,
42,
true
],
[
"TJDF",
5,
5,
43,
true
],
[
"TJES",
0,
0,
44,
true
],
[
"TJGO",
2,
2,
45,
true
],
[
"TJMA",
0,
0,
46,
true
],
[
"TJMT",
3,
3,
47,
true
],
[
"TJMS",
1,
1,
48,
true
],
[
"TJMG",
3,
3,
49,
true
],
[
"TJPA",
0,
0,
50,
true
],
[
"TJPB",
0,
0,
51,
true
],
[
"TJPR",
9,
9,
52,
true
],
[
"TJPE",
0,
0,
53,
true
],
[
"TJPI",
0,
0,
54,
true
],
[
"TJRJ",
15,
15,
55,
true
],
[
"TJRN",
1,
1,
56,
true
],
[
"TJRS",
12,
12,
57,
true
],
[
"TJRO",
0,
0,
58,
true
],
[
"TJRR",
0,
0,
59,
true
],
[
"TJSC",
8,
8,
60,
true
],
[
"TJSP",
33,
33,
61,
true
],
[
"TJSE",
0,
0,
62,
true
],
[
"TJTO",
0,
0,
63,
true
],
[
"CNJ",
0,
0,
100,
false
]
],
"unit_cost":2.5
}
Parâmetro |
Tipo |
Descrição |
---|---|---|
relatorio_id |
integer |
ID Digesto do relatório. |
is_monitored_parts |
boolean |
Indica se as partes do relatório devem ser monitoradas por distribuição. |
mes_max |
integer |
Indica até qual mês cada ano filtrado pela data de distribuição deve ir. |
mes_min |
integer |
Indica a partir de qual mês cada ano filtrado pela data de distribuição deve começar. |
ano_max |
integer |
Ano de distribuição do processo mais recente encontrado. |
ano_min |
integer |
Ano de distribuição do processo mais antigo encontrado. |
data_distribuicao |
list |
Listagem com a quantidade de processos distribuídos por ano. Cada uma no formato |
list |
Lista de tuplas com quantidade de processos por natureza. |
|
list |
Lista de detalhes das partes que compõem o relatório. |
|
total_cost |
float |
Custo do relatório caso venha a ser encomendado. |
total_procs |
integer |
Total mínimo de processos a serem incluídos no relatório. Processos encontrados além dessa quantidade não serão cobrados. |
total_procs_max |
integer |
Estimativa para a quantidade máxima de processos esperada para o relatório. |
list |
Lista de tuplas com quantidade de processos por tribunal. Cada tupla contém esses campos: |
|
unit_cost |
float |
Valor (R$) unitário de cada processo encontrado. |
Nota
Pode ocorrer do ID Jusbrasil da variação de nome em variações retornar como null. Como mostrado do exemplo abaixo.
Exemplo de resposta com ids nulos:
HTTP/1.1 200 OK
Vary: Accept
Content-Type: application/json
{
"ano_max":2013,
"ano_min":2012,
"data_distribuicao":[
[
"2012",
"1"
],
[
"2013",
"1"
]
],
"is_monitored_parts":false,
"mes_max":12,
"mes_min":1,
"naturezas":[
[
"OUTROS",
0,
10,
0,
true
],
[
"ARQUIVO",
0,
10,
17,
true
]
],
"partes":[
{
"checked":true,
"id":257,
"nome":"ROSA POLTRONIERI",
"parte_max_total":20,
"total_procs_variacoes":100,
"variacoes":[
[
"ROSA MARIA POLTRONIER SILVA",
1,
1,
31272688,
true,
1
],
[
"ROSA MARIA POLTRONIERI PAVANI",
1,
1,
null,
true,
1
]
]
}
],
"total_cost":5.0,
"total_procs":2,
"total_procs_max":2,
"tribunais":[
[
"TRF2",
1,
1,
9,
true
]
],
"unit_cost":2.5
}